Owner description: At the base of the majestic Outeniqua mountains in the Wilderness, lies our little charming horse ranch, Black Horse Trails. We are a relaxed and friendly bunch with whom you can enjoy a precious few hours of your holiday time, in a true animal crazy environment.The beautiful Friesian horse is our breed of choice for our trail riding due to their friendly, easy going temperaments and good manners.We have suitable steeds for any level of experience you may or may not have on a horses back, everyone is welcome! « less

A few days ago, I had the honour of experiencing a three hour ride on my last day in the Wilderness. The trail is about 18km long and the absolute highlight for me was riding silently through the indigenous lush serene forest. Lindsey was professional and her horses were well-kept and trained. The stables were next to her personal farm, which is also worth visiting too. Her love for animals is very evident indeed.
